IMAQ Resources, LLC is seeking a highly organized and motivated Office Administrator to support the Air Force Utilities Privatization (UP) and Enhanced Use Lease (EUL) programs. These initiatives are transforming Air Force installations nationwide by leveraging private-sector expertise and investment to modernize and sustain critical infrastructure.
As part of the IMAQ team, the Office Administrator will play a key role in advancing these programs by providing administrative, coordination, and documentation support that enables effective collaboration between government, industry, and program leadership

- Support AFCEC UP program leadership and project managers in day-to-day administrative operations.
- Manage document control, version tracking, and correspondence for multiple active utility privatization projects.
- Coordinate meetings, prepare agendas, record minutes, and track action items to completion.
- Maintain and organize program schedules, deliverables, and stakeholder contact lists across government, contractor, and utility partners.
- Prepare and format briefings, reports, and internal communications in accordance with Air Force and DoD standards.
- Assist in the preparation, review, and submission of official documentation, including contract modifications, data calls, and program updates.
- Provide logistical and administrative support for workshops, site visits, and stakeholder engagements.
- Track tasker deadlines and ensure alignment with established reporting requirements and program milestones.
- Support onboarding, access requests, and records management within AFCEC and Air Force system
